Nick Mariano's Baller Ranks is a weekly fantasy baseball rankings list for the top 101 starting pitchers. He ranks and analyzes updated pitcher values for Week 18.

August is now upon us, which means two months of the fantasy baseball season remain! There is still plenty of ball to be played with workload limitations creeping up on us (and tack fallout still making itself known), so let's look back at July stats with an update of my weekly Starting Pitcher Baller Ranks. This brings you my top 101 SPs moving forward. I'd let my All-Star break Rest of Season ranks do the talking for mid-July, but it's time to re-roll these bad boys for the final months!

Click the link! This google sheet accompanies the table below and adds relevant 5x5 stats, K%, BB%, BABIP, FIP, xFIP, SIERA, ERA-FIP, and CSW%. Do note that I leave off most injured players, and removing those injured players can give an illusion that others have risen despite mediocre performances. I highly encourage you to click the link.

To be clear, these Rest of Season ranks are geared towards traditional 5x5 leagues sans most injured SPs, lest a return is imminent. If 25% of the board is on the IL, then it isn't terribly actionable, and I'll intermittently weave in updates of where I'd throw them in if they were healthy. For now, let's dive into my Top 101 SPs and be sure we've got the best rotation possible.
